A well-regarded educational institution in Tenby seeks a Design Technology Teacher to inspire students across various key stages. Candidates should possess the ability to teach Design Technology and Engineering, demonstrating a commitment to maximizing pupil potential and high educational standards.
The role involves teaching across Year 7 to Year 9 and contributing to KS4 and KS5. Welsh language skills are desirable. This position offers a supportive environment within a scenic location.
